Answer:
A monsoon is a seasonal shift in the prevailing wind direction, that usually brings with it a different kind of weather. ... Widespread torrential rains, and even severe thunderstorms, large hail and tornadoes can accompany the onset of the summer monsoon.
Monsoon tends to have 'breaks' in rainfall; which means that there are wet and dry spells in between. The monsoon rains take place only for a few days at a time and then come the rainless intervals.
